Summary
Appeal from the Iowa District Court for Lee (South) County, Mark E. Kruse and Michael J. Schilling, Judges. AFFIRMED. Considered by Bower, C.J., and May and Greer, JJ. Opinion by Bower, C.J. (9 pages)
Nicholas Burgess appeals from the sentence imposed upon his conviction for delivery of a schedule II controlled substance (morphine), contending the prosecutor breached the plea agreement to recommend a suspended sentence and his defense counsel was ineffective in not objecting. OPINION HOLDS: Given the favorable plea agreement offered by the State, Burgess’s extensive criminal history, and the PSI recommendation, it was reasonable for the prosecutor to acknowledge the defendant’s criminal history to explain the State’s recommendation for a suspended sentence. We therefore affirm.
